The document discusses using semantic web technologies and linked data to support real-time emergency response. It describes using an RDF triplestore accessed by agents to integrate data from various external sources and provide an overall picture to emergency responders through HTML5 apps. The system utilizes standard vocabularies and reuses existing linked open data to represent incident data, locations, addresses and other relevant information.
